logo

Output 96120131ee5a98596685d23aa48925439b32a11207f6da49d7c20328a84bfc2e:0

value
1153421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e66066ea8b00401b8d18ed8d32307e927a5ef8c OP_EQUALVERIFY OP_CHECKSIG
address
15ELJewqHJDKLoub3tVFhmpcw7s29tctFV
transaction
96120131ee5a98596685d23aa48925439b32a11207f6da49d7c20328a84bfc2e